TICKET-4412: Queuescale autoscaler stopped scaling the Fenwick ingest pool. Root cause: the service credential for the Brimhall metrics API expired last Tuesday; scaler silently fell back to min replicas. Rotation cadence is 90 days — add a calendar reminder or automate it. Restart queuescaled after replacing the credential. The replacement key for the Brimhall metrics API is below.

API key for fahip-kahip: zpat23_XiJGUHz5xfaAtaIqUkus0rh

## Deploying the Gatewick Proctor Queue

Deploys are pretty painless: push to main, wait for the pipeline, then watch the queue drain dashboard for five minutes. If candidates pile up mid-exam, roll back first and ask questions later — the queue replays safely. Everything the workers care about lives in one config block, shown here for reference.

settings of bafof-yagef:
JOROX_PIN=8740
JOROX_TENANT=pelox
JOROX_METRICS_HOST=metrics.jorox.qorvelworks.internal
JOROX_SEAL=seal_c78f63c1
JOROX_STANDBY_TEAM=norax

**Ticket TM-309: Telemetry payload compression regressions on Beaconly agents**

Welcome, new folks — context: Beaconly agents gzip telemetry before upload, but v3.1 accidentally disabled compression for batches under 4KB, inflating bandwidth by 18%. Fix restores the threshold check in the encoder. Verify with the staging dashboard after deploy. The build token for the patched agent appears below.

session token of tajef-bageg = htk21_5d90d574934f3ccae6437